Honor Win vs Motorola ThinkPhone

The Honor Win (2026) runs on the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Elite Gen 5, while the Motorola ThinkPhone (2023) runs on the Qualcomm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1. By overall MobileRank rating, the Honor Win leads — 78/100 vs 64/100 (a 14-point difference). Key differences: the Honor Win has the bigger battery (10000 mAh vs 5000); the Honor Win is faster in AnTuTu (3,873,442 vs 1,289,763); the Motorola ThinkPhone is noticeably lighter (188g vs 229g).

The Honor Win is noticeably better than the Motorola ThinkPhone — the overall rating gap is 14 points.

Specs comparison
Specification Honor Win Motorola ThinkPhone
Processor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Elite Gen 5 Qualcomm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1
AnTuTu 3873442 1289763
Geekbench Single 3640 1761
Geekbench Multi 11033 4688
Display 6.8" AMOLED 6.6" P-OLED
Resolution 1272x2800 1080x2400
Refresh rate 120 Hz 144 Hz
Battery 10000 mAh 5000 mAh
Charging 100W 68W
Wireless charging 80W 15W
Main camera 50 MP 50 MP
Ultrawide 8 MP 13 MP
Front camera 50 MP 32 MP
RAM 12GB / 16GB 8GB / 12GB
Storage 256GB / 512GB / 1TB 128GB / 256GB / 512GB
OS Android 16 Android 13
